Dapper Spliton, In our case, Dapper reads the result from left to rig
Dapper Spliton, In our case, Dapper reads the result from left to right and starts . By explicitly specifying split points, you ensure Dapper Discover how to effectively use Dapper's `SplitOn` feature to map complex SQL queries to your DTOs in C# . ArgumentException will be thrown with a helpful message. And we need to specify the splitOn Dapper’s multi-mapping is a powerful tool for mapping join queries to objects, but it relies on splitOn when working with non-"Id" keys. Dapper supports multi-mapping, which allows you to map a single row to multiple objects. This is useful if you need to retrieve data from multiple tables in a single query. This guide covers everything from setup to executi Dapper will automatically look for a column called Id to split on but if it does not find one and splitOn is not provided a System. Of course it will add an extra column to your return resultset, but that is extremely minimal overhead for the Dapper maps the order columns to a new Order object for every row – which is why you need to de-dupe and keep track of unique Order objects by We must also tell Dapper how to map the LineItem and Product from the result set into a single LineItem object. Dapper, a popular micro-ORM (Object-Relational Mapping) The splitOn parameter indicates where the second object begins in the result set. So although it is In C# application development, retrieving data from relational databases and mapping it to object hierarchies is a common task. See examples of one Dapper will only split on Id by default, and that Id occurs before all the Customer columns. dry6, n0hy, f9pl, 60gwhr, rccsm, fky9fo, fhycs, xcs44, rwg9n, gk37k,